Understanding Cataract Surgery Refine



Checking out the steps associated with cataract surgery can assist relieve any type of anxiety or uncertainty you may have regarding the procedure. Cataract surgery is a common and very successful procedure that involves removing the over cast lens in your eye and changing it with a clear artificial lens.

Before the surgical procedure, your eye will certainly be numbed with eye decreases or an injection to ensure you do not really feel any discomfort throughout the procedure. The surgeon will certainly make a little cut in your eye to access the cataract and break it up making use of ultrasound waves before thoroughly removing it.

When the cataract is gotten rid of, the artificial lens will certainly be inserted in its location. The entire surgical treatment usually takes around 15-30 minutes per eye and is generally done one eye at once.

After the surgical procedure, you might experience some mild discomfort or blurred vision, yet this is regular and should boost as your eye heals.

Post-Operative Treatment Tips



After cataract surgical procedure, supplying proper post-operative care is vital for your liked one's recovery. Ensure they use the protective guard over their eye as instructed by the medical professional. Help them provide recommended eye drops and medications on time to prevent infection and aid recovery.

Urge your loved one to stay clear of touching or massaging their eyes, as this can bring about issues. Assist them in complying with any kind of restrictions on flexing, lifting heavy objects, or taking part in strenuous tasks to prevent pressure on the eyes. Ensure they go to all follow-up appointments with the eye doctor for keeping an eye on progression.



Keep the eye area tidy and dry, avoiding water or soap straight in the eyes.
